Move disable_target_specific_optimizations to bfd_link_info
authorH.J. Lu <hjl.tools@gmail.com>
Wed, 24 Oct 2012 11:09:28 +0000 (11:09 +0000)
committerH.J. Lu <hjl.tools@gmail.com>
Wed, 24 Oct 2012 11:09:28 +0000 (11:09 +0000)
commit4f9d22a0b15a371db7df4b41c1633fde25932ff1
treeaa6979c634219b862efa215bac762baf06d62365
parent35c813e2242319efee1bad5c7cdd6e7e224ce94e
Move disable_target_specific_optimizations to bfd_link_info

include/

* bfdlink.h (bfd_link_info): Add
disable_target_specific_optimizations.

ld/

* ld.h (command_line): Remove
disable_target_specific_optimizations.
(RELAXATION_DISABLED_BY_DEFAULT): Removed.
(RELAXATION_DISABLED_BY_USER): Likewise.
(RELAXATION_ENABLED): Likewise.
(DISABLE_RELAXATION): Likewise.
(ENABLE_RELAXATION): Likewise.

* ldmain.c (main): Updated.

* ldmain.h (RELAXATION_DISABLED_BY_DEFAULT): New macro.
(RELAXATION_DISABLED_BY_USER): Likewise.
(RELAXATION_ENABLED): Likewise.
(DISABLE_RELAXATION): Likewise.
(ENABLE_RELAXATION): Likewise.
include/ChangeLog
include/bfdlink.h
ld/ChangeLog
ld/ld.h
ld/ldmain.c
ld/ldmain.h